Incident with Issues and Pages

Incident Report for GitHub

Resolved

On July 8th, 2024, between 18:18 UTC and 19:11 UTC, various services relying on static assets were degraded, including user uploaded content on github.com, access to docs.github.com and Pages sites, and downloads of Release assets and Packages.

The outage primarily affected users in the vicinity of New York City, USA, due to a local CDN disruption.

Service was restored without our intervention.

We are working to improve our external monitoring, which failed to detect the issue and will be evaluating a backup mechanism to keep critical services available, such as being able to load assets on GitHub.com, in the event of an outage with our CDN.
